How can I use a variable from a different data source into my report.  Both sources have a common key. For example in one report I am using contract number and a product Id.  Now I want to bring the customer name from a different data source using the contract number as a primary key for both sources.

Hi,

To get the functionality as you require, you have to use "Prepare Data" using the common field or primary key. According to my knowledge it can't be achieved directly in the report designer if you are having two different data sources with common field.
